A Usage Analysis on a job will only find a "job" in which the selected job was used if the selected job is in a successfully compiled sequence. The Usage Anaysis will find the sequence.

Usage Analysis is primarily intended to be used with table definitions, stage types, data elements, transforms and routines, to answer the question "in which jobs is this component used?". Primarily table definitions, so that you can assess the impact on your DataStage jobs when the table structure is changed.
